Epic Chain (EPIC), the successor to Ethernity Chain (ERN), was approved by 97.1% of the community and now operates as an ETH Layer 2 blockchain. Focused on Real World Assets (RWAs) and entertainment, it integrates AI-driven security, DRM, and Web3 technology. With the entertainment market set to hit $3.5 trillion by 2030, Epic Chain enables global brands to bring franchises on-chain, already featuring icons like Messi, Shaq, and Muhammad Ali. Now, it expands into top entertainment franchises with improved scalability, security, and efficiency.
